Typically, performance oriented people go the other way - convert dbw systems back to throttle cable systems, as the dbw system offers you no real advantage, and adds a layer of complexity (and possibly unreliability).

In order to run a drive by wire system you will need:

Accelerator pedal with as least two different output signals (outputs can be offset, inversed, or a ratio, but shouldn't be exactly the same)

A throttle body that has an electronic motor on it (which you have) and has a built in TPS (throttle position sensor).

You will then need a computer that will read in your accelerator pedal and control the throttle position while monitoring the throttle position in real time.  Each throttle body will need its own input and output to the computer.

How can you disagree about the comlexity of a simple cable vs. a completely computerized system?

A thottle cable is the most basic you can get.  I'm not saying that DBW systems are rocket science, but side by side there is much more to them. 

I highly doubt you will ever see a production vehicle without a TPS sensor on a DBW car.  DBW systems are built to be redundent and failsafe.  If any part of the system were to fail the ECU should be able to detect the failure immediately and prevent engine damage (through fuel/spark cut).  Without a throttle position sensor if the throttle motor were to break or stick the ECU would have no way of monitoring it.  at least on a throttled car you KNOW when the throttle is stuck based on pedal position - it gives the operating feedback and the ability to shut the motor off in order to protect the motor.

I've never seen an aftermarket DBW controller.  They may exist, but if they don't that will add one more layer of complexity as you will have to build one!

Thanks for the responses guys. The Emerald system isnt just a flash reprog.. its a 3d mappable management system designed to give various outputs in relation to various inputs. I am going to try and make up a pedal pot for my car using the parts from an Audi A3 which uses a tbw system (the parts are reasonably cheap too). It shouldnt be too difficult. The reason why I am thinking about using tbw as opposed to just a cable driven system is that the bike bodies that I am using have a steeper sweep than a standard car body. This will lead to quite a jerky acceleration if I would convert the system to cable driven. With tbw, this problem should be solved to  a great extent. As stated above, there are ALWAYS two signals that are somehow related, but not exact in the pedal.  Some of them are inversed, some are offset, etc, but there are always two.

Second, you wouldn't want to connect the pedal (pot) directly to the motor.  It wouldn't work.  You would not be able to reliably put enough current through the pot to move the motor fast enough.  This type of circuit should only be used as an input in to a computer system (very low load).
